Jessica Biel is set to play the role of Candy Montgomery in an upcoming limited Hulu Series, Candy. The series will premiere on May 9.

The true crime, drama series, Candy, is about a typical 1980s housewife, Candy Montgomery, who has the perfect life; a nice house in the suburbs, an ideal husband named Pat Montgomery, two kids, even the perfect secret affair. But nothing can be perfect for long. Struggling to deal with life, Montgomery lashes out in an attempt for a little bit of freedom, leading to deadly consequences.

The series is based on the true story of Candy Montgomery, who was acquitted for killing her friend Betty Gore in self-defense after Gore confronted Montgomery about her affair with her husband, Allan Gore.

The news of the series was announced back in July 2020, with Elisabeth Moss set to play the lead role in the series, but she backed out due to scheduling issues.

The cast of Candy includes Jessica Biel, Melanie Lynskey (Two and a Half Men), Timothy Simons (The Hustle), Pablo Schreiber (Orange Is the New Black), and Raúl Esparza (Hannibal).

Executive producers for the limited series are Robin Veith (Law & Order: Special Victims Unit), Michael Uppendahl (Adam), Nick Antosca (The Act) with Alex Hedlund (Chucky) under Antosca’s production company, Eat the Cat, Jessica Biel (The Sinner) and Michelle Purple (Cruel Summer) will executive produce under Iron Ocean. Veith has also written the pilot script, and Uppendahl will also direct the pilot.
